Expectations

A covenant, not a contract.

Acceptance into The Legion Project is acceptance of a covenant. Eleven expectations — agreed to in writing, lived out in daily practice.

  1. 01

    Live as a faithful Christian

    Daily prayer, Scripture, and a public Christian witness. Faith is the foundation of the program.

  2. 02

    Meet weekly with your assigned mentor

    No exceptions, no postponements. The mentor relationship is the spine of restoration.

  3. 03

    Attend church every Sunday

    A local body of believers, chosen in coordination with your mentor.

  4. 04

    Participate in a small group

    A men's Bible study, accountability group, or church small group — engaged weekly.

  5. 05

    Respect women — no premarital relationships

    Honor toward women in word and deed. No sexual relationships outside of marriage during the program.

  6. 06

    Keep a written budget

    Track income and expense weekly with your mentor. Financial discipline is restoration.

  7. 07

    Abstain from substances

    No alcohol, no illicit drugs, no misuse of prescription medication. Period.

  8. 08

    No weapons

    Firearms and weapons of any kind are not permitted while in the program.

  9. 09

    Full legal compliance

    Honor every condition of parole, every appointment, every requirement of the law.

  10. 10

    Honor the repayment obligation

    Repay funds advanced as employment is established — the sustainability of the next man depends on it.

  11. 11

    Follow mentor directives

    Submit to the spiritual and practical direction of your assigned mentor and of The Legion Project leadership.
